How Does Qi2 Technology Improve Wireless Charging Speed and Efficiency?

Qi2 technology improves wireless charging speed and efficiency through several key advancements. First, it introduces a new communication protocol. This protocol enhances the interaction between charger and device, allowing faster data exchange. Second, it employs more efficient power transfer methods. Qi2 can deliver higher wattage to compatible devices. This increased wattage shortens charging time and improves efficiency.

Third, Qi2 technology supports magnetic alignment. This feature ensures that devices align perfectly with the charger. Proper alignment reduces energy loss during the charging process. Fourth, Qi2 enhances heat management. It incorporates better thermal regulation to maintain optimal operating temperatures. This feature prevents overheating and ensures safe charging.

Fifth, Qi2 technology is backward compatible. It works with existing Qi chargers, providing a seamless transition for users. This compatibility allows users to benefit from the new technology without needing to replace their current equipment. Overall, these components collectively improve charging speed and efficiency, making Qi2 a significant advancement in wireless charging technology.

What Are the Advantages of Using MagSafe for iPhone Wireless Charging?

The advantages of using MagSafe for iPhone wireless charging include enhanced alignment, improved charging efficiency, and a wide range of accessories.

  1. Enhanced Alignment
  2. Improved Charging Efficiency
  3. Wide Range of Accessories

1. Enhanced Alignment:
Enhanced alignment occurs due to the magnetic connection in MagSafe technology. MagSafe uses magnets to ensure that the charger aligns perfectly with the iPhone. This precise alignment promotes effective power transfer. A study by iFixit in 2020 indicated that improved alignment reduces energy losses and enhances charging speed.

2. Improved Charging Efficiency:
Improved charging efficiency is achieved through the optimized power delivery system of MagSafe. The technology can deliver up to 15 watts of power, compared to the standard 7.5 watts for regular wireless chargers. According to Apple, this increased wattage allows for faster charging without overheating, which prolongs the lifespan of the battery.

How Can You Ensure Your Wireless Charging Pad is Compatible with Different iPhone Models?

To ensure your wireless charging pad is compatible with different iPhone models, check the charging standards, verify device specifications, and choose pads with versatile design features.

  1. Charging Standards: Most iPhones utilize the Qi wireless charging standard. This universal standard enables compatibility with a wide range of charging pads. For example, iPhone 8 and later models support Qi charging, making them compatible with any Qi-certified pad. The Wireless Power Consortium established this standard to promote interoperability among devices.

  2. Device Specifications: Review the specifications of the iPhone models you own. iPhones released from 2017 onward generally support wireless charging. According to Apple, the iPhone 8, 8 Plus, X, XR, XS, XS Max, 11, 11 Pro, 11 Pro Max, SE (2nd generation), 12, 12 Mini, 12 Pro, 12 Pro Max, 13, 13 Mini, 13 Pro, 13 Pro Max, 14, 14 Plus, 14 Pro, and 14 Pro Max all support wireless charging.

  3. Versatile Design Features: Look for charging pads that specify compatibility with multiple devices. Some pads offer features like built-in magnets or adjustable coils to accommodate phone positioning. This ensures that even with different cases, you still get optimal charging performance. Additionally, some brands provide compatibility lists to help users verify if their devices will work with the charging pad.

  4. Output Power: Ensure that the charging pad has the correct output power. iPhones typically charge at 7.5 watts when using a Qi charger. Some pads offer faster charging abilities, which can provide a better charging experience for supported devices. Check product descriptions for their output ratings to ensure proper function and efficiency.

By following these guidelines, you can confidently choose a wireless charging pad that meets your needs across various iPhone models.
